I just saw an craigslist ad for a Jotul 8. They say it is only 3 years old - but I thought these were discontinued a while ago. Does anyone know when these were discontinued?
Thanks
 
Its been well over 10 years since they were made. Come to think of it , it may be closer to 15. The #8 was never and EPA stove.
 
Probably meant 30. My neighbor has one from the eighties. Looks like a Castine. puffs smoke in the beginning, but burns pretty clear after that. They run it hot. Pretty nice stove.
 
It's the predecessor to the F400 Castine. They did make a cat version (8TDC) that sold later. But even so, that would date the stove to the 1990s.
